Re: 56 shop truck build

That's the idea behind it Rod. I want to make it look as naturally aged as I can. Right now we are sanding with 400 grit to get the bulk of the blue sanded. Then I'll move to an 800 grit to feather out some edges and then to a scotch brite pad to make sure everything is the same shade of dull.
